COT(number) Function
Calculates the cotangent of the argument “number”.
This function returns a numeric value negative, positive or zero. The cotangent
is a discontinuos function, therefore, there are values for which the cotangent
is not defined. When yoy generate the graph of the cotangent function, you must
select the range indicated for not getting erroneos results. For example:
=COT(PI()/2) Returns 0.
=COT(-PI()/2) Returns 0.
=COT(0,5) Returns 1,83.
